The soup should remain covered so steam can build up and cook the top of the dumplings while the simmering liquid cooks the bottom. Leftover dumpling soup can be stored in the refrigerator for up to two days. Reheat it gently on the stovetop or in the microwave, just until everything is warm.

In this way,What happens to water vapor when the lid is removed?
If the lid is removed, the partial pressure of water vapor above the water is by approximation equal to the partial pressure in your kitchen (especially if you have a steady stream of ‘fresh’ air). With a lower partial water vapor pressure, the liquid will start evaporating more readily.

Considering this,Can you cook dumplings on top of stew?
Dumplings are essentially a soft biscuit dough that can be cooked on top of a stew or other hot liquid, such as a fruit sauce. Some recipes call for shaping and rolling the dough out and cutting it into pieces, while others call for spooning the dough onto the hot liquid.
What’s the best way to boil a dumpling?
Once boiling, place the dumplings in, cover, and steam on medium to medium high heat for 8-10 minutes. The water should be simmering enough to generate steam. It should not be at a rigorous boil that bubbles up and touches the dumplings or evaporates the water too fast. That’s it!

How long does it take to cook a Turkey in a frying pan?
Fry the turkey about 3-4 minutes per pound until the turkey reaches an internal temperature of about 165f degrees (if thermometer is inserted into the breast meat) and 180f degrees (if thermometer is inserted into the thigh meat.) What happens when you put a lid on a pot?
Very little water vapor escapes the pot or pan while covered. Most of the water vapor created by simmering instead condenses on the inside of the lid and soon rejoins the dish. The gas underneath the lid is mostly water vapor at close to the boiling point. There is very little evaporation from the food.
Why do you cook dumplings in a covered pot?
The baking powder in the mix causes dumplings to rise during cooking, a reaction that is most evident when the batter is dropped rather than rolled. Most dumpling recipes call for cooking them in a tightly covered pot, because they actually cook in the steam created by the boiling stew or fruit.
When do you open the lid on a Turkey?
Just make sure you uncover the lid about 30 minutes before the turkey’s done roasting so the skin has a chance to get crispy. Many recipes today will instruct you to cook your bird in a roasting rack tented with foil.
